Market Overview:
Home medical equipment refers to medical devices that help patients recover, monitor, or manage their medical conditions at home. This equipment includes mobility equipment, home respiratory therapy equipment, home dialysis equipment, adult diapers, canes, crutches, patient lifts, CPAP machines, ventilators, among others. With growing geriatric population worldwide suffering from mobility issues and chronic diseases, home medical equipment are playing a vital role in enabling independent living and homecare. Home medical equipment industry is gaining popularity as it reduces healthcare costs while improving patient care experience.

Market key trends:
One of the key trends in the home medical equipment market is growing popularity of remote patient monitoring. With technological advancements, home medical devices are increasingly being integrated with connectivity and remote monitoring capabilities. This allows patients to stay connected with their healthcare providers and continuously monitor health parameters from home. It also enables early detection of health deteriorations and prevents unnecessary hospital visits. Growing preference for homecare over hospitals is further driving innovation and adoption of remote patient monitoring technologies in the home medical equipment market. This trend is expected to significantly impact market growth over the forecast period.
Porter’s Analysis
Threat of new entrants: Low barrier to entry as manufacturing of home medical equipment does not require high capital investments. However, existing major players have advantages of economies of scale and brand recognition.
Bargaining power of buyers: Buyers have moderate bargaining power due to presence of many players. However, specialized nature of products gives advantages to few major brands.
Bargaining power of suppliers: Suppliers have low bargaining power due to fragmented nature and availability of substitutes. However, suppliers of core medical devices have some bargaining power.
Threat of new substitutes: Threat is moderate as new medical technologies can disrupt existing products. However, regulations ensure technological changes are gradual.
Competitive rivalry: High as major players compete on innovation, quality and pricing.

Regional analysis
North America dominates the global market led by the US due to supportive reimbursement policies and advanced healthcare infrastructure. Asia Pacific is expected to witness fastest growth owing to rising healthcare expenditure in countries like China and India.
